Country 105 Caring for Kids Radiothon Raises $2.86 Million!

Twenty-year total surpasses $43 million for the Alberta Children’s Hospital!

For 20 incredible years, supporters of the Country 105 Caring For Kids Radiothon have stepped up with incredible generosity to help children and families at the Alberta Children’s Hospital.

To help celebrate the event’s 20-year milestone, long-time Radiothon donor and Calgary philanthropist, Tom Crist, matched every donation up to $1 million. That boosted the generosity of Radiothon supporters to an astounding $2.87 million final tally, making the overall Radiothon total more than $43 million since 2003!

“We are so grateful to the hundreds of people – hundreds of Country 105 listeners – who have literally been part of Radiothon since day one,” says Saifa Koonar, President & CEO, Alberta Children’s Hospital Foundation. “They called in with their gifts back in 2003 and are still donating today! We’re so thankful for all of them…and everyone who has stood with these families and the hospital since then!”

Over the past three days, dozens of grateful families lined up – virtually – to share how much they appreciate the care they’ve received from the Alberta Children’s Hospital and highlighted in very real terms how donations help save and change lives at the hospital every day.

“We’ve always known we have the best listeners,” says Greg Johnson, Program Director, Country 105 FM. “And with such a tremendous response to our 20th Caring for Kids Radiothon, it’s clear, we have the most generous, too. It’s amazing that they step up in a big way to help kids and families – and so rewarding that every year, we do it together.”

The official phone bank sponsor of this year’s event – for the 13th year in a row – was Brookfield Residential.
